London: Ghost Story Press, (1997). Maloret, Nick. Limited Edition. Hardcover. No. 228 of 400 copies, octavo size, 478 pp., signed by Ron Weighell. Fine. Item #21102209

Ron Weighell (1950-2020) authored an extensive collection of fantasy, horror, and supernatural stories, with his work included in over fifty anthologies published around the globe and at least six volumes of his work alone.

Per Wiki, Weighell’s work "is characterized by his knowledge of incunabula, architecture, art and art symbolism, mysticism, and the occult, and pays homage to his two primary influences, M. R. James and Arthur Machen. While his protagonists are typically scholars, archaeologists, and bibliophiles, much of his fiction moves beyond traditional antiquarian ghost stories to explore both wonder and terror in the presence of supernatural forces."

Weighell noted in the Introduction to this book that this collection of his stories, "extensivly revised and corrected, now represents all the short fiction to date that I would wish to see preserved." The stories are divided into three sections: "Gods and Strangers: Summoning by Theurgy", "Dark Devotions: Antiquarian Horrors", and "Sorcery and Sanctity: Machenesque Fantasies".

___DESCRIPTION: Bound in full tan linen cloth over boards, the front stamped with lettering, a decoration of a demon, and a ruled border with corner decorations all in green, the spine also with green lettering and the demon, the back stamped with a depiction of the Gorgon's head and the same border as the front both in green, top edge stained green, light tan endpapers, frontispiece by Nick Maloret one of twenty-two full-page and five in-text black-line illustrations bound in throughout, signature of Ron Weighell in green ink on the title page, limitation statement on the copyright page, each story with a 7-line initial captial letter; octavo size (9 1/2" by 6 1/4"), pagination: [i-viii] ix-xxi [3, blank, sectional title, blank] 1-451 [3, blank, Sources, Acknowledgements]. Issued without a dust jacket.
